Pizza Hut Offer


FYI
Pizza Hut is offering free DVD's with a full priced large pizza. Mr. Mom, All Dogs go to Heaven, Bill and Ted's and Honeymoon in Vegas. The offer began the end of June and runs for about 6 weeks.

As you would expect, 4:3, no features and plenty of previews and even a Pizza Hut Literacy Program ad.

But you know what? Pizza was ok and I still enjoyed MR. Mom !!
